Vienna's Strategic Location

Vienna, the capital of Austria, is strategically located in the heart of Europe, making it a crucial hub for executive recruitment. Its central position allows easy access to major European cities, facilitating seamless business operations and travel. This geographical advantage is a significant draw for multinational companies looking to establish a presence or expand their operations in Europe.

The city is well-connected through a robust transportation network, including Vienna International Airport, which offers direct flights to numerous global destinations. This connectivity makes Vienna an attractive location for executives who need to travel frequently for business.

Quality of Life and Talent Attraction

One of the key reasons Vienna is a hub for executive recruitment is its exceptional quality of life. The city consistently ranks high in global livability indexes, offering a safe, clean, and culturally rich environment. This high standard of living is a major draw for top executives and their families.

Vienna's excellent education system, world-class healthcare, and vibrant cultural scene make it an appealing destination for professionals looking to relocate. These factors not only attract talent but also help in retaining it, ensuring that businesses have access to a steady stream of qualified candidates.

Networking Opportunities and Business Culture

Vienna's business culture is characterized by a strong emphasis on networking and relationship-building. The city hosts numerous international conferences, trade shows, and industry events, providing ample opportunities for executives to connect and collaborate.

The presence of various business chambers and professional associations further enhances networking opportunities, allowing executives to engage with peers, share insights, and foster partnerships. This collaborative environment is conducive to innovation and growth.

Government Support and Incentives

The Austrian government offers various incentives and support programs to attract foreign businesses and talent to Vienna. These initiatives include tax benefits, grants, and assistance with regulatory processes. Such support makes it easier for companies to establish operations and recruit top talent in the city.

Additionally, Vienna's stable political environment and strong legal framework provide a secure foundation for businesses to operate, giving executives confidence in the city's long-term prospects.
